In one example of this our client was starting a new business to accept entries to fairs and livestock shows over the internet for events around the country. We began by creating a working demo of the web site so that potential customers could see the functionality that was being offered. Then as our client received their first events we created a fully functional web application from the ground up.

Some key features of this application include:

  • Complete online administration that allows our client to create new events from any computer on the Internet.
  • Any number of category levels can be created for each event.
  • The creation of custom entry forms.
  • Logos of each event can be displayed and a direct link from the events web site to their categories.

For example our client can create an event with a main category, two sub-categories, and a unique form for each sub-category designating which fields are required or creating drop down boxes with choices.

People signing up for an event can go directly to an event through a link or search the events offered. They then drill down through whatever categories are set up and fill out the entry form. They are able to upload files and view records of events they have signed up for.
